Introduction
Calcium iodate, a compound composed of calcium and iodine, has garnered attention as an essential trace mineral in animal feed nutrition. Iodine, a vital component of thyroid hormones, plays a crucial role in various physiological processes, including metabolism, growth, reproduction, and immune function. This article provides an in-depth examination of the uses and efficacy of calcium iodate in feed nutrition, its mechanisms of action, potential benefits, and considerations for its integration into modern livestock management practices.
Importance of Iodine in Animal Nutrition
Iodine is an essential element that cannot be synthesized by animals and must be provided through their diets. Its primary function lies in the synthesis of thyroid hormones, namely thyroxine (T4) and triiodothyronine (T3). These hormones are central to regulating metabolic rate, energy utilization, and overall growth. Iodine deficiency can lead to reduced feed efficiency, impaired reproduction, and compromised immune responses in animals.
Mechanisms of Action
Calcium iodate serves as a bioavailable source of iodine in animal feed. Once ingested, it is absorbed in the digestive tract and transported to the thyroid gland, where it participates in the synthesis of thyroid hormones. These hormones, in turn, exert their effects on various physiological processes, promoting normal growth, development, and metabolic functions.
Feed Nutrition Enhancement
The incorporation of calcium iodate into animal feed is aimed at addressing iodine deficiency and promoting optimal growth, reproduction, and overall health. Adequate iodine levels are particularly crucial for pregnant and lactating animals, as thyroid hormones influence fetal development and milk production.
Proposed Benefits
-
Thyroid Hormone Regulation: Calcium iodate supplementation ensures the availability of iodine for the synthesis of thyroid hormones. These hormones play a pivotal role in maintaining metabolic balance, energy utilization, and growth in animals.
-
Growth and Development: Adequate iodine levels contribute to proper skeletal and muscular development in young animals. It supports normal cell division, aiding in the growth of tissues and organs.
-
Reproductive Health: Iodine is essential for normal reproductive function. Adequate thyroid hormone levels are crucial for estrous cycling, conception, and successful pregnancy in livestock.
-
Immune Function: Thyroid hormones are known to influence immune responses. Ensuring sufficient iodine levels can contribute to robust immune defenses and disease resistance in animals.
Considerations and Challenges
While calcium iodate supplementation holds great potential for livestock nutrition, several important considerations must be addressed:
-
Dietary Iodine Levels: It's essential to strike a balance between providing adequate iodine and avoiding excessive levels that could lead to toxicity. Regular monitoring and adjustment of dietary iodine content are crucial.
-
Feed Formulation: Proper incorporation of calcium iodate into feed formulations to ensure uniform distribution and accurate dosing is critical.
-
Species-Specific Requirements: Different livestock species have varying iodine requirements. Formulating diets to meet the specific needs of each species is essential.
-
Environmental Impact: Proper disposal of manure containing iodine is necessary to prevent potential environmental contamination.
